Social Media Inbox – Quick Overview
A social media inbox is a centralized dashboard that gathers all your social media messages, comments, and interactions in one place. Instead of logging into each app separately, you can respond to comments across platforms from one dashboard.
Think of it like your email inbox, but for all your social accounts. With a unified messaging platform for social media, you can:
Monitor and reply to social media comments efficiently
Track engagement in real time
Streamline customer service on social platforms
Improve response time with social media inbox tools
Centralize social media messages and comments
How to Manage Instagram, Facebook, and LinkedIn Comments in One Inbox
Here’s a step-by-step guide to managing all your comments from Instagram, Facebook, and LinkedIn using a unified social media inbox for comments.
Step 1: Choose the Right Unified Social Media Inbox Tool
Pick a social media comment management tool that supports Instagram, Facebook, and LinkedIn. A great choice is SocialBu.
The best social media monitoring and response tool will help you easily manage every platform.
Step 2: Connect Your Accounts
After signing up, link your Instagram, Facebook, and LinkedIn accounts. This step is called inbox integration for social media marketing, and it enables the tool to consolidate all your comments and messages into a single, unified inbox.
To add accounts, click on the name icon in the top right corner and tap on ‘Social Accounts’.
Then click on ‘Add Account’, and select the platform you want to add the unified social media inbox tool.
Here you can add accounts of your choice.
Step 3: Respond and Automate the Unified Inbox
Now you can see all your comments in one place. No more switching between platforms. This allows:
Centralized comment moderation for social platforms
Manage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n messages together
Faster replies and better social media customer service
Streamlined social media engagement with a unified inbox
Click on the Respond feature to check comments on your social media accounts.
To check all your comments in one place, click on the Feed you want to check.
Here, you can view all your posts, including comments, replies, and even type a private note.
This can also increase social media engagement.
Most social media inbox automation tools offer analytics. Track how quickly you respond, see which platforms generate the most engagement, and gain a deeper understanding of your audience.
Step 4: Track Engagement and Improve Performance
Most social media inbox automation tools come with engagement analytics and real-time message tracking. You can:
Measure your response time
See which platforms drive the most engagement
Improve your strategy based on insights

Who Benefits From a Unified Inbox?
A unified inbox for social media interactions is perfect for:
Marketing Teams
They can centralize and streamline responses across platforms like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, and more. This enhances team coordination and facilitates faster, more consistent responses.
Customer Support Teams
A digital customer support system enables them to respond quickly to questions or complaints from various platforms in a single dashboard. This means better online reputation management and happier customers.
Social Media Managers
It’s perfect to manage multiple social account comments easily. No need to switch between apps, just log in once and see everything in your all-in-one social media inbox.
Agencies
Agencies can manage engagements for multiple clients using a single platform. It’s ideal for tracking messages, assigning replies, and managing everything from a social media inbox for agencies and brands.
Small Businesses
With a multi-platform comment management tool, small businesses can improve customer relationships by replying faster and keeping all messages in one organized place.
Regardless of your business size, a unified social media inbox tool can help you respond more quickly, stay organized, and increase engagement.
